A five-day seminar on global trends in the digital economy has started in Turkmenistan. It is organized within the framework of the project «Capacity Building of the Academy of Civil Service under the President of Turkmenistan», which is implemented by the United Nations Development Program and the Academy of Civil Service under the President of Turkmenistan.

The course in a hybrid format is held with the participation of representatives of various ministries and departments of Turkmenistan, representatives of the parliament, banking institutions of the country, as well as the hakimlik of the city of Ashgabat. It is aimed at building the capacity of civil servants in the field of digital transformation and improving the efficiency of public administration through the introduction of digital technologies.

So, during it, the participants will get acquainted with the best practices of digitalization of the country's economy, learn about the main trends and prospects in this area. Together with Andrey Leonovich, an international consultant in the field of innovative solutions, they will also discuss the principles of working with databases and issues of ensuring cybersecurity.

The expert expressed confidence that this seminar would help Turkmen specialists to get new ideas for the development and implementation of digital technologies, and accelerate the digital transformation in the country.

The project «Improving the capacity of the Academy of Civil Service under the President of Turkmenistan» is aimed at improving the level of professional training of civil servants, as well as promoting young professionals (including women) in leadership positions.

It is expected that within the framework of the project, a certificate program for improving the level of professional qualifications of civil servants will be developed and implemented and cooperation with international partners will be established in priority areas for the development of state authorities and local governments in the context of digital transformation.
